iOS6 Developer Preview Accepting Some Airline Boarding Passes Into Passbook

One of the new features Apple unveiled in iOS6 was the Passbook application, billed to be a central repository for all things ticket related; movie tickets, retail coupons, loyalty cards and boarding passes.

Ausbt.com has a story sent in by on of their users, showing that the backend for this is already fully integrated by some companies.

Reader Shaun Lorrain checked in for a Virgin Australia flight using the airline’s mobile website on his iPhone, which is running a developer preview edition of iOS 6 – and received the following prompt.

Apple also said that Passbook is time and location sensitive, so as the time approaches that you will need a specific item, such as a boarding pass for a flight, Passbook will show these on your lock screen for you, so you can access them straight away.
